Atabaev Timur %A Nang Dinh Nguyen %A Yoon-Hwae Hwang %A Hyung-Kook Kim %J Journal of Sol-Gel Science and Technology %T Luminescent core–shell Fe3O4@Gd2O3:Er3+,Li+Composite Particles with Enhanced Optical Properties %X Bifunctional magneto-optical nanocomposites with Fe3O4 nanoparticles as a core and erbium and lithium codoped gadolinium (Gd2O3:Er3+, Li+) as the shell were synthesized successfully using a simple urea homogeneous precipitation method. The fabricated Fe3O4@Gd2O3:Er3+, Li+ particles were characterized by X-ray diffraction, field emission scanning electron microscopy, transmission electron microscopy, photoluminescence spectroscopy and quantum design vibrating sample magnetometry. The upconversion emission intensity was enhanced significantly comparing to that without Li+ ions. These bifunctional composites are expected to be potentially applied for drug delivery, cell separation and bioimaging. %N 3 %P 391-395 %V 71 %D 2014 %R 10.1007/s10971-014-3382-9 %L SisLab1253
